How to model a dice in anim8or this tutorial is mostly directed at those with little or no experiance with anim8or, you will learn how to model a simple subdivided dice with some materials. Step 1. First add a cube with the cube icon double click on the cube and add these settings
then click on build > convert to mesh. What this does is allows you to edit the cube object by moving or adding points, edges or faces. Step 2. Now the cube is a mesh object we can start editing it. Go into top view by clicking view > top or pressing 5 on your number pad.
